The time period ?exosome? refers to the greatly targeted subset of extracellular vesicles, which might be produced by a certain mobile pathway and show diameters spanning roughly 30?150 nanometres. But this may be a deceptive title to the preparations now really being examined preclinically, which often comprise a spread of non-exosomal vesicles. ?Nobody must claim they have obtained a 100% pure preparation,? suggests Gimona.
Further variability concerning preparations can come up inside a variety of strategies. Many studies have founded that different types of stem cell?and experienced cells, for that matter?produce cell-specific swimming pools of vesicles with distinctive contents. Some researchers wish to exploit this therapeutically; one example is, Shetty?s lab has found evidence that vesicles from neural stem cells enhance more-efficient neuronal restore than these from MSCs. But even various cultures with the identical cell form may well generate vesicles with distinctive useful houses. ?You may take the same MSC, increase it in numerous labs and it’ll behave differently,? suggests Lim. These discrepancies end up being yet far more obvious with MSCs from donors who vary in age, sexual intercourse and other organic reasons.
Organizations like the Global Culture for Extracellular Vesicles are developing greatest methods for creating and characterizing exosome preparations for medical examine. The processes needed to make uniform preparations of exosomes appropriate for medical screening are costly. Therefore, merely a handful of academic centres are at this time capable to go after human trials. Gimona and Rohde are doing the job at their institution?s clinical-grade website here producing facility to optimize the medium- to large-scale manufacture of trial-ready MSC exosomes. And Kalluri?s team has garnered adequate funding from MD Anderson and philanthropic teams to assistance the start of the website here phase I medical demo of exosome therapy for pancreatic most cancers, which began accruing sufferers this March.
